Kamathi to get separate DyCP office: Maha minister

Nagpur, Mar 15 (UNI) Maharashtra and District Guardian Minister Chandrasekhar Bawankule said on Saturday that as the Kamthi city is expanding and in order to give proper security and direction to this expansion, an up-to-date independent Deputy Commissioner of Police office will be set up there.
Speaking at a meeting organised in connection with Kamthi Metro Phase 2 expansion at District Planning Building in Sadar, he instructed to plan this office in a way so that all CCTV cameras in Kamathi will be connected with control room, war room, ACP office, police station, parking facility.
The new DCP's office will be constructed in the form of a ground floor-plus-two storey building.
